Security Officer - weekends

    Job Summary

    16 hour Weekend Days

    Availability to work 6:30 AM – 2:30 PM on Saturdays and Sundays.

    Requirements:
    Ability to respond quickly and effectively to emergency and non-emergency calls.
    Strong report-writing and documentation skills.
    Excellent customer service and community policing approach.
    Experience handling emotionally charged situations and de-escalating conflicts.
    Ability to investigate suspicious activity, security incidents, and safety concerns.
    Ability to protect patients, visitors, staff, and hospital property.
    Experience working in healthcare, security, law enforcement, military, or public safety environments is beneficial.

    Job Duties:
    Security patrols and access control.
    Emergency response and incident management.
    Report writing and documentation.
    Customer service and public interaction.
    Conflict resolution and de-escalation.
    Investigations and evidence gathering.
    Radio communications and dispatch coordination.
    Safety inspections and hazard identification.
    Hospital, healthcare, campus, or institutional security environments.

    Qualifications

    Required Qualifications

    • High school diploma or GED
    • Valid Massachusetts driver's license
    • Ability to obtain and maintain:
      • CPR/AED/First Aid certification
      • CPI De-Escalation Training certification
      • IAHSS Basic Officer Certification (within first 90 days)
    • Fluent English reading, writing, and speaking skills
    • Basic computer and report-writing skills

    Preferred Qualifications

    • Associate's or bachelor's degree in Criminal Justice or a related field
    • 1–3 years of security, law enforcement, military, healthcare security, or related experience
    • Fluency in a second language
